What if your IT professional quit tomorrow?

Just imagine the situation. It's Monday morning, you arrive at your office and find a notice on your desk that your IT guy is quitting with no notice. Whether he is your employee or a independent professional, what would you do? Do you have a plan? 

Would you have the information you needed to transition to a new provider or hire a new IT professional or is it all in your IT professionals head?

Don't be caught off guard! Make sure you have the following critical information documented and accessible:

  • All usernames, passwords, and administrator information for computers, switches, firewalls, and servers.
  • All usernames and passwords for your technology vendor’s portals including your email provider, website host, domain registrar and other 3rd party vendors. 
  • Purchased software and product keys
  • Diagram of your network structure with IP addresses, devices, and how they are connected
  • Documented backup and recovery plan
    • Do you know how long a recovery would take and what the steps are? 

If you don't have any of the above information easily accessible, now is the time to gather it and store it in a safe place.
